Noise in images

During shooting at slow shutter speeds, noise may appear on-screen. These phenomena are
caused when current is generated in those sections of the image pickup device that are not normally
exposed to light, resulting in a rise in temperature in the image pickup device or image pickup device
drive circuit. This can also occur when shooting with a high ISO setting in an environment exposed
to heat. To reduce this noise, the camera activates the noise reduction function.

Bulb shooting

You can take a picture with a bulb exposure time in which the shutter stays open as long as you hold
down the shutter button. Set the shutter speed to [BULB] in the M mode. Bulb shooting can also be
done using an optional remote control (RM-1).

TIPS

The picture looks blurred:

J The use of a monopod or tripod is recommended when taking a picture at slow shutter speed.
